WebERISA Lawsuit against American United Life Insurance after final denial of group long-term disability benefits; and; Lump-sum buyout or settlement of an American United Life … WebShort-term disability is a weekly benefit with a limited duration – up to one year maximum in most cases. Long-term disability, on the other hand, is paid monthly and employees may receive benefits until they reach Social Security normal retirement age (SSNRA) or age 65. Stability and peace of mind for health and recovery Web14. mar 2024. · As the names imply, short-term disability is used to cover injuries or illnesses that persist for a shorter amount of time (usually less than six months or one year, depending on your plan). In contrast, long-term disability insurance comes into play for issues that will take you out of work for longer than that.
